**Zlatko Nastevski** ([Macedonian](/source/Macedonian_Language): Златкo Hacтeвcки; born 4 August 1957) is a retired [Macedonian](/source/Macedonians_(ethnic_group)) [footballer](/source/Association_football) who played as an [attacking midfielder](/source/Attacking_midfielder).

In October 2009, he played in the Australian "Olderoos" squad in the World Masters Games. Nastevski currently devotes his time to training Australia's future football talent through his academy NDFD.

## Honours

**Marconi Fairfield**

- [NSL Championship](/source/List_of_NSL_champions): [1988](/source/National_Soccer_League_1988), [1989](/source/National_Soccer_League_1989)

**Individual**

- [NSL](/source/National_Soccer_League) Player of the Year: [1989](/source/National_Soccer_League_1989) with [Marconi Fairfield](/source/Marconi_Fairfield)

- [NSL](/source/National_Soccer_League) Top Scorer: [1989](/source/National_Soccer_League_1989) with [Marconi Fairfield](/source/Marconi_Fairfield) (20 goals)
